(1.) Through this appeal under section 173 of Motor Vehicles Act, 1988, the appellants seek to modify the award dated 6.11.1993 passed by learned Judge, Motor Accidents Claims Tribunal, Jaipur City, Jaipur whereby the learned Judge has awarded a sum of Rs. 1,63,500 under different heads.
(2.) On 14.6.1988 at 9.45 p.m., when Daljeet Singh was on way at M.I. Road, Jaipur, a minibus bearing No. RND 0285 hit him. It was alleged that the driver was driving the bus rashly and negligently and with excessive speed. As a result of this accident, Daljeet Singh sustained serious injuries and ultimately he succumbed to his injuries. It was stated that at the time of accident the age of deceased was 38 years and was posted as driver in Rajasthan Agriculture Marketing Board.

Learned Tribunal having concluded that the accident occurred as a result of contributory negligence of deceased and the driver of said minibus awarded compensation to the tune of Rs. 3,27,000 and since the accident took place as a result of contributory negligence, the Tribunal deducted 50 per cent of the award amount, that is, Rs. 1,63,500, thereby making the claimants entitled to get compensation to the tune of Rs. 1,63,500. It further appears that the Tribunal has made the insurance company liable to pay the compensation only to the extent of Rs. 50,000.
